A thief made off with $2 million worth of jewelry belonging to Paris Hilton after ransacking her L.A. home on Friday morning. A guard in Hilton's gated community reported a burglar "wearing a hooded sweat shirt and gloved" entered the home around 4am Friday while Hilton was out on the town. In its initial investigation, the LAPD reported that the crime did not appear to be a professional burglar and that Hilton's front door was unlocked. "I expect we'll be able to apprehend the culprit here based on some of the information we have," said Deputy Chief Charlie Beck. (Photo: WENN)
